Sic Parvis Magna has become a popular script tattoo design or larger illustration. The quote comes from the Latin and means “Thus great things from small things (come).” It’s the heraldic motto of legendary seafarer Sir Francis Drake that also features in the hugely popular Unchartered series of video games, where Drake’s ancestor Nathan is the star.
